Risk management becomes an increasingly important companion on this journey. This extends beyond simple diversification. It involves setting clear exit strategies for both potential gains and losses. For example, a trader might decide to sell a portion of their holdings if a cryptocurrency doubles in value, thereby securing profits and reducing their exposure. Similarly, setting stop-loss orders can automatically trigger a sale if an asset's price falls below a predetermined threshold, limiting potential downside. This disciplined approach prevents emotional decision-making from derailing long-term progress.
The evolution of the crypto market has also given rise to various investment vehicles and strategies. Staking, for instance, allows holders of certain cryptocurrencies (like Ethereum after its transition to Proof-of-Stake) to earn passive income by locking up their assets to support the network's operations. This not only provides a yield but also reinforces the security and decentralization of the blockchain. Yield farming and liquidity providing in DeFi protocols offer potentially higher returns, though they often come with greater complexity and risk, including impermanent loss and smart contract vulnerabilities. Understanding the nuances of these strategies is crucial for maximizing returns while managing exposure.

At its heart, a blockchain is a chain of blocks, each containing a batch of transactions. These blocks are cryptographically linked together in chronological order, creating a permanent and tamper-proof record. Imagine a digital ledger, not held by a single authority, but distributed across a vast network of computers. Every participant on this network holds an identical copy of the ledger. When a new transaction occurs, it’s broadcast to the network. A consensus mechanism, a set of rules agreed upon by the network participants, then validates this transaction. Once validated, the transaction is added to a new block, which is then appended to the existing chain. This distributed nature makes it incredibly difficult to alter or corrupt any data because a malicious actor would need to gain control of a majority of the network's computing power to change even a single block, a feat that is practically impossible on large, established blockchains.
The magic of blockchain lies in its foundational pillars: decentralization, cryptography, and transparency. Decentralization, as mentioned, means no single point of control. This eliminates the need for intermediaries like banks or credit card companies, cutting out fees and reducing the risk of a single entity failing or acting maliciously. Cryptography provides the security. Each block is secured with complex mathematical algorithms, ensuring the integrity of the data within. Public and private keys are used to authenticate transactions, ensuring that only the rightful owner can access and spend their digital assets. Transparency, while not always absolute in all blockchain implementations, is a key feature of many public blockchains. While the identities of participants may be pseudonymous (represented by alphanumeric addresses), the transactions themselves are often publicly viewable, allowing anyone to audit and verify the ledger. This inherent transparency fosters accountability and trust, as all actions are recorded and visible.
The genesis of blockchain technology is often attributed to the pseudonymous entity known as Satoshi Nakamoto, who published the white paper for Bitcoin in 2008. This paper outlined a peer-to-peer electronic cash system that would allow online payments to be sent directly from one party to another without going through a financial institution. The underlying technology to achieve this was the blockchain. While Bitcoin brought blockchain into the public consciousness, its potential extends far beyond digital currencies. The ability to create a secure, shared, and immutable record of virtually any type of data has opened up a Pandora's Box of possibilities.
Consider the implications for supply chain management. Currently, tracking goods from origin to destination can be a labyrinthine process, prone to fraud, errors, and delays. With blockchain, each step of a product's journey – from raw material sourcing to manufacturing, shipping, and final delivery – can be recorded on an immutable ledger. This provides unprecedented visibility, allowing consumers to verify the authenticity and ethical sourcing of products, and businesses to identify bottlenecks and improve efficiency. Imagine scanning a QR code on your coffee beans and seeing the entire journey from the farm, including details about the farmer, the harvest date, and transit conditions – all validated on a blockchain.

The concept of smart contracts, self-executing contracts with the terms of the agreement directly written into code, further amplifies blockchain’s power. These contracts automatically execute actions when predefined conditions are met, eliminating the need for manual intervention and reducing the risk of disputes. For instance, an insurance policy could be programmed to automatically disburse funds to a policyholder upon verified confirmation of a covered event, like a flight delay.
The journey of blockchain from a niche concept to a global phenomenon hasn't been without its challenges. Scalability has been a significant hurdle, with many early blockchains struggling to process a high volume of transactions quickly and affordably. Energy consumption, particularly for blockchains that rely on "proof-of-work" consensus mechanisms, has also been a point of contention, sparking innovations like "proof-of-stake" and other more energy-efficient alternatives. Regulatory uncertainty is another factor, as governments worldwide grapple with how to classify and govern this nascent technology. Despite these hurdles, the pace of innovation is relentless. Developers are constantly working on solutions to enhance scalability, improve energy efficiency, and develop user-friendly interfaces, paving the way for broader adoption. One of the most significant advancements beyond cryptocurrencies is the advent of programmable blockchains, with Ethereum leading the charge. Ethereum introduced the concept of smart contracts, which are essentially self-executing agreements where the terms of the contract are directly written into lines of code. This innovation shifted the paradigm from a simple ledger of transactions to a platform capable of running decentralized applications (dApps). These dApps can range from decentralized finance (DeFi) protocols that offer lending, borrowing, and trading without traditional financial intermediaries, to decentralized autonomous organizations (DAOs) that allow for community-governed decision-making, and even decentralized social media platforms that give users more control over their data.
